So a little cheese tip for people who are having difficulty taking down the raid boss during the few rounds he debuffs the right stat:
Proceed as normal until you get to the 3rd round of the debuff you want
Ex: Assuming you want DEF debuffed for your physical attacks, if he debuffs DEF at the start, fight as normal until round 3. If debuffs SPR, proceed as normal until round 6 when he's about to switch back to debuff SPR.
On this round, restart the app, re-open it and tap "yes" when it asks if you want to play mission.
Do your last round of fighting normally. His turn counter will now be reset, so he won't switch to the debuff, and will remain debuffing DEF. You'll now have an extra round or two of the debuff you want to finish him.
